Traditional Or Complementary Medicine Associate Professional SOP Examples
1. Patient Assessment S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to outline the process of conducting a comprehensive assessment of patients seeking traditional or complementary medicine. It includes gathering medical history, conducting physical examinations, and assessing the patient’s overall health and well-being. The scope of this SOP covers all patients visiting the healthcare facility. The person responsible for this SOP is the Traditional or Complementary Medicine Associate Professional. This SOP references the Patient Record Management SOP for documenting the assessment findings.
2. Treatment Planning S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to establish guidelines for developing individualized treatment plans for patients based on their assessment results. It includes determining the appropriate traditional or complementary medicine techniques, setting treatment goals, and outlining the frequency and duration of treatments. The scope of this SOP covers all patients receiving traditional or complementary medicine services. The person responsible for this SOP is the Traditional or Complementary Medicine Associate Professional. This SOP references the Patient Assessment SOP for utilizing assessment findings in treatment planning.
3. Treatment Delivery S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to provide a standardized approach for delivering traditional or complementary medicine treatments to patients. It includes techniques such as acupuncture, herbal medicine, massage therapy, or other modalities. The scope of this SOP covers all patients receiving treatment at the healthcare facility. The person responsible for this SOP is the Traditional or Complementary Medicine Associate Professional. This SOP references the Treatment Planning SOP for implementing the treatment plan.
4. Infection Control S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to establish protocols for maintaining a clean and safe environment to prevent the spread of infections. It includes guidelines for hand hygiene, disinfection of treatment rooms and equipment, and proper waste management. The scope of this SOP covers all staff members involved in providing traditional or complementary medicine services. The person responsible for this SOP is the Infection Control Officer. This SOP references the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) SOP for ensuring staff members have access to appropriate protective gear.
5. Documentation and Record Keeping S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to outline the procedures for documenting patient information, treatment details, and maintaining accurate records. It includes guidelines for maintaining confidentiality, recording treatment progress, and storing records securely. The scope of this SOP covers all staff members involved in providing traditional or complementary medicine services. The person responsible for this SOP is the Traditional or Complementary Medicine Associate Professional. This SOP references the Patient Assessment SOP and Treatment Planning SOP for documenting assessment findings and treatment plans.
6. Emergency Response S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to establish protocols for responding to medical emergencies that may occur during traditional or complementary medicine treatments. It includes guidelines for recognizing emergency situations, contacting emergency medical services, and providing basic life support if necessary. The scope of this SOP covers all staff members involved in providing traditional or complementary medicine services. The person responsible for this SOP is the Emergency Response Coordinator. This SOP references the Infection Control SOP for maintaining a safe environment during emergencies.
7. Continuing Education and Professional Development SOP: The purpose of this SOP is to outline the requirements and procedures for ongoing education and professional development for Traditional or Complementary Medicine Associate Professionals. It includes guidelines for attending workshops, conferences, and staying updated with the latest research and advancements in the field. The scope of this SOP covers all Traditional or Complementary Medicine Associate Professionals employed at the healthcare facility. The person responsible for this SOP is the Professional Development Coordinator. This SOP references the Treatment Delivery SOP for incorporating new techniques and approaches learned through professional development
